                MEASURE PLACED ON THE CALENDAR--S. 3299

  Mr. SCHUMER. Madam President, I understand that there is a bill at 
the desk that is due for a second reading.
  The PRESIDING OFFICER. The clerk will read the bill by title for the 
second time.
  The senior assistant legislative clerk read as follows:

       A bill (S. 3299) to prohibit the Department of Defense from 
     discharging or withholding pay or benefits from members of 
     the National Guard based on COVID-19 vaccination status.

  Mr. SCHUMER. In order to place the bill on the calendar under the 
provisions of rule XIV, I would object to further proceeding.
  The PRESIDING OFFICER. Objection having been heard, the bill will be 
placed on the calendar.
